I enjoyed this book which others have compared to a dark twist on The Breakfast Club (I'm of that generation that can relate to and appreciate that reference). When a strict teacher sends 5 students to detention and 1 of them dies shortly after it begins, all are suspects. The characters represent several issues that teens are actually facing, some better than others. The story is somewhat predictable, but still enjoyable.
